Online Application Process

Get your TD Travel credit card to join the Expedia for TD rewards program. Source: Freepik.
Get your TD Travel credit card to join the Expedia for TD rewards program. Source: Freepik.

Before you start redeeming your Expedia For TD rewards points, you’ll need to get one of the eligible TD Travel credit cards. After you get approved for one of these cards, you can enroll for Expedia For TD.

Also, as long as you have your TD account, you can log in to TD Rewards and sign up to get access to Expedia For TD.

Other ways to join

As we mentioned, you’ll need to have a TD Travel Rewards credit card to redeem your points through Expedia For TD. But, you need to do it online by accessing your TD Rewards account.

Expedia For TD vs. Scotia Scene+

If you are not sure about joining the Expedia For TD rewards program, we can help you out with a different option.

With the Scotia Scene+ rewards program, you can redeem your Scene+ points for groceries, travel, movies, and more!

Moreover, with Scotia Scene+, you can also redeem your points for car rentals, rides, hotels, flights, and more, just as you can with Expedia For TD.

However, if you are looking for a way to redeem your points for broader categories, Scene+ may be your best choice.

But if you only mind getting travel perks, you can be fine with the Expedia For TD rewards program.
